Common Misconceptions About Dog Food
There are several misconceptions about dog food that could potentially harm your pup’s health. It’s essential to be aware of these misconceptions and make informed choices when selecting food for your furry friend.
- Myth: All dog food is created equal. In reality, the quality of ingredients varies significantly between brands.
- Myth: Homemade diets are always better for dogs. While some homemade diets can be beneficial, it’s crucial to ensure they provide all necessary nutrients.
- Myth: Grain-free diets are always the healthiest option. While some dogs may benefit from a grain-free diet, others may require grains for optimal health.
Understanding Dog Food Labels
Reading dog food labels can be confusing, but it’s essential to understand what you’re feeding your pup. Look for the following key aspects when selecting a dog food:
- Real meat as the first ingredient
- Whole grains and vegetables for added nutrients
- Avoidance of artificial preservatives, flavors, and colors
- Complete and balanced for your dog’s life stage
Common Questions About Dog Food Nutrition
Here are some common questions pet owners have about dog food nutrition:
- How much should I feed my dog? Portion sizes vary depending on your dog’s age, size, and activity level. Consult with your veterinarian for personalized recommendations.
- Should I choose dry or wet dog food? Both dry and wet food can be nutritious options. Some dogs may benefit from a combination of both.
- Do I need to supplement my dog’s diet? Most high-quality dog foods provide all necessary nutrients, but your vet may recommend supplements based on your dog’s individual needs.
